Deputies: Deadly crash kills 1, injures several more

Officials say driver of truck arrested for driving while intoxicated

ATASCOCITA, Texas – Deputies say a crash in Atascocita left one person dead and several others injured.

The accident occurred around 2 a.m. Saturday in the 6900 block of East FM 1960 near Timber Forest Drive.

Investigators said Colby Fitzgerald was in a Toyota Camry with three others. The driver of the Camry pulled out from a shopping center onto FM 1960, according to deputies.

Deputies said upon approach to the Toyota car in the right traffic lane, a black Ford truck changed lanes to the left lane. The driver of the Toyota changed lanes to the left in front of the Ford truck.

Then, deputies said the front-right of the Ford truck had struck the left side of the Toyota vehicle.

Investigators said the two cars collided, killing Fitzgerald and sending three other people in the car to the hospital in serious condition. No one in the truck was seriously hurt, deputies said.

Officials said the 18-year-old driver of the truck was arrested for driving while intoxicated.
